## Service Accounts — Fanout Backpressure

Quick heads-up for reviewers: the `notif-fanout` service account is the one that throttles downstream pushes when Pigeonline's queue depth spikes. It's scoped read-only on the subscriber registry and write-only on the delivery ledger, nothing else. When backpressure kicks in, it sheds low-priority topics first, so don't panic if digest sends lag during load tests. Rotation happens quarterly via the Hatchway pipeline. For staging verification, the service authenticates with the key below.

gateway credential: kto3_qfe

Subject: Next Year's Headcount Plan

Hi all,

Quick heads-up for the sales leads: next year's headcount plan adds six quota-carrying roles, mostly in the Varnholt territory, plus two sales-ops hires. Backfills get priority through Q1; net-new reqs open in Q2. Nothing's locked until the board signs off, so keep this loose for now. One more thing you need to see before your team briefings.

internal memo for yahag-tahog: The pricing group signed off on a budget of $152.8 million for Project Soriel.

**Support Onboarding: SpokeShift**

SpokeShift is Pedalgrid's rebalancing tool for the Varnmouth bike-share fleet. It reads dock occupancy every five minutes and issues van routing suggestions. Support handles stuck-route tickets only; dispatch logic belongs to the Fleet team. Run it locally with `spokeshift serve --region varnmouth`. Config lives in `.env` at the repo root. Most values are prefilled by the bootstrap script. The dispatch API token is the exception. Add the following line to your .env:

secret setting of bagag-fafof: LEDGER_TOKEN29=2087e95a7be258fc3f2cc54ea20c7